Automated tenant screening has become essential for multifamily property managers who want to fill vacancies quickly while maintaining high tenant quality standards. Traditional manual screening processes often create bottlenecks that delay leasing decisions, frustrate prospective tenants, and leave units vacant longer than necessary. Modern automated tenant screening solutions transform this workflow by leveraging AI and integrated technology platforms to verify applicant information, assess risk factors, and ensure compliance with fair housing regulations: all while dramatically reducing the time investment required from leasing teams.
The shift toward automation addresses critical pain points that multifamily properties face daily. Manual screening typically involves collecting paper applications, making phone calls to verify employment and rental history, waiting for credit reports to arrive, and manually cross-referencing information across multiple systems. This process can take days or weeks to complete, during which qualified applicants may find housing elsewhere and revenue-generating units remain empty.
Tenant screening serves as the foundation for successful multifamily operations by helping property managers identify applicants who are most likely to pay rent on time, follow lease agreements, and maintain positive relationships within the community. The screening process traditionally encompasses several key verification areas that work together to create a comprehensive applicant profile.
Financial verification examines an applicant's ability to afford the rental payment consistently. This includes reviewing credit scores, analyzing debt-to-income ratios, verifying employment status and income levels, and checking for previous bankruptcies or foreclosures. Most properties require applicants to earn at least three times the monthly rent to qualify, though this multiple can vary based on local market conditions and property positioning.
Background and history checks focus on identifying potential risk factors that could impact the applicant's tenancy success. Criminal background checks reveal any concerning legal issues, though fair housing laws require property managers to consider the nature, severity, and recency of any offenses. Eviction history searches help identify patterns of lease violations or non-payment, while rental history verification provides insights into how applicants have treated previous properties and relationships with prior landlords.
Identity and fraud verification has become increasingly important as rental scams and false applications have grown more sophisticated. This process confirms that applicants are who they claim to be, validates the authenticity of submitted documents, and flags inconsistencies that might indicate fraudulent activity.

Artificial intelligence fundamentally changes tenant screening by automating data collection, verification, and risk assessment processes that previously required extensive manual effort. AI-powered systems can instantly verify information across multiple databases, identify patterns that human reviewers might miss, and flag potential red flags for further review.
Automated data collection begins the moment a prospective tenant submits an inquiry. Instead of waiting for leasing staff to manually gather information, AI systems can immediately capture applicant details, cross-reference them against property requirements, and determine initial qualification status. This instant pre-screening eliminates unqualified prospects before they schedule tours, saving time for both applicants and leasing teams.
Real-time verification processes leverage AI to simultaneously check multiple data sources within minutes rather than days. Credit bureaus, criminal databases, employment records, and rental history platforms can all be queried automatically, with results compiled into comprehensive reports that highlight key decision factors. Machine learning algorithms continuously improve accuracy by learning from past decisions and outcomes.
Intelligent risk assessment represents one of the most valuable AI capabilities for multifamily properties. Rather than simply presenting raw data, AI systems can analyze patterns across thousands of similar applications to predict tenant success probability. These algorithms consider multiple variables simultaneously: credit trends, employment stability, rental payment history, and other factors: to provide nuanced risk assessments that support informed decision-making.
The advantages of implementing automated tenant screening extend far beyond simple time savings, creating transformational improvements across multiple operational areas that directly impact property performance and profitability.
Accelerated leasing velocity provides immediate competitive advantages in fast-moving rental markets. Properties using automated screening can often provide approval decisions within hours rather than days, allowing qualified applicants to secure units quickly before exploring other options. This speed advantage becomes particularly crucial during peak leasing seasons when multiple properties compete for the same tenant pool.
Enhanced compliance protection reduces legal risks associated with fair housing violations and discriminatory practices. Automated systems apply identical screening criteria to every applicant, documenting the decision-making process and eliminating subjective biases that could lead to discrimination claims. Built-in compliance features automatically update to reflect current regulations and provide audit trails for regulatory reviews.
Improved decision accuracy results from comprehensive data analysis that humans cannot match manually. AI systems can identify subtle patterns and correlations across vast datasets, flagging potential risks or opportunities that traditional screening methods might overlook. This enhanced accuracy helps property managers avoid costly placement mistakes while identifying high-quality tenants who might have been rejected using outdated screening approaches.
Resource optimization allows leasing teams to focus on high-value activities rather than administrative tasks. When routine verification processes run automatically, staff members can dedicate more time to prospect relationship building, property tours, and community management activities that directly influence leasing success and tenant satisfaction.

Successful automated tenant screening implementation requires careful planning that considers existing workflows, staff capabilities, and property-specific requirements. The most effective approaches gradually introduce automation while maintaining familiar processes during transition periods.
Workflow integration should align automated screening with current leasing procedures rather than requiring complete process overhauls. Properties can begin by automating specific verification components: such as credit checks or employment verification: while maintaining manual processes for other areas. This phased approach allows teams to become comfortable with new systems while identifying optimization opportunities.
Staff training and change management become crucial for realizing automation benefits. Leasing teams need to understand how automated systems work, what information they provide, and how to interpret AI-generated insights effectively. Training should emphasize how automation enhances rather than replaces human judgment in tenant selection decisions.
Compliance monitoring requires ongoing attention to ensure that automated screening processes align with evolving fair housing regulations and local tenant protection laws. Properties should establish regular review procedures to verify that screening criteria remain legally compliant and that automated decisions can be properly documented and defended if challenged.
Performance measurement helps properties optimize their automated screening implementation over time. Key metrics include average screening completion time, application approval rates, tenant quality scores, and leasing velocity improvements. Regular analysis of these metrics can identify areas where screening criteria or processes might need adjustment.
Automated screening systems excel at managing multiple simultaneous applications, a common challenge for popular multifamily properties during peak leasing periods. Traditional manual processes often struggle to handle multiple qualified applicants fairly and efficiently, leading to delayed decisions and frustrated prospects.
Priority ranking algorithms can automatically sort applications based on qualification strength, application completeness, and submission timing. This ranking provides property managers with clear guidance about which applicants deserve immediate attention while ensuring that all prospects receive fair consideration according to objective criteria.
Automated communication workflows keep all applicants informed about their status throughout the screening process, reducing anxiety and improving the overall experience. Systems can automatically send updates when applications are received, when screening begins, and when additional information is needed, maintaining engagement without requiring manual outreach from leasing staff.
The combination of speed and thoroughness that automated screening provides becomes particularly valuable when properties need to make quick decisions about multiple qualified applicants. Rather than rushing through manual verification processes to meet timeline pressures, property managers can rely on comprehensive automated reports to make confident decisions quickly.
